 Plant RVA Natives

The Plant RVA Natives campaign is a marketing effort to showcase the colorful, beautiful variety of plants native to the Virginia Capital Region, which includes Henrico, Hanover, City of Richmond, Chesterfield, Charles City, New Kent, Powhatan, Goochland, Cumberland, and Amelia.

The Plant RVA Natives campaign promotes the use of plants native to the region in urban and suburban landscapes for their many social, cultural, and economic benefits, and to increase the availability of these native plants in retail centers throughout the region.

A new LandscapE design is available for the Richmond Region

Native Garden Designs offered by Wild Ones are ready-to-use garden plans created by regional native plant experts. Each design matches plants to the ecoregion’s soil, sun, and climate conditions, helping you create a beautiful native garden or landscape that supports wildlife and thrives naturally.
